integration-testing
✓Guía de pruebas, simulacros y simulaciones de un extremo a otro para el código base de Muni. Úselo al escribir pruebas de integración, configurar entornos de prueba, crear simulacros de bus CAN, probar protocolos WebSocket, validar dispositivos de bases de datos o depurar fallas de pruebas. Cubre patrones de prueba de Rust (tokio::test, pruebas de integración), pruebas de TypeScript (Vitest), infraestructura simulada (Docker Compose para pruebas), simulación de bus CAN, clientes de prueba WebSocket, inicialización de bases de datos y validación de grabaciones de repetición. Esencial para garantizar que los componentes funcionen juntos correctamente.
Instalación
SKILL.md
Comprehensive guide for testing integration points across the Muni system.
Testing Approaches: | Component | Test Type | Tools | Location |
| Rust firmware | Integration tests | tokio::test, mocks | tests/ directory | | TypeScript console | Component/E2E tests | Vitest, Testing Library | src//.test.tsx | | Depot services | Integration tests | tokio::test, Docker | tests/ directory | | Python workers | Unit/integration | pytest | tests/ directory |
Guía de pruebas, simulacros y simulaciones de un extremo a otro para el código base de Muni. Úselo al escribir pruebas de integración, configurar entornos de prueba, crear simulacros de bus CAN, probar protocolos WebSocket, validar dispositivos de bases de datos o depurar fallas de pruebas. Cubre patrones de prueba de Rust (tokio::test, pruebas de integración), pruebas de TypeScript (Vitest), infraestructura simulada (Docker Compose para pruebas), simulación de bus CAN, clientes de prueba WebSocket, inicialización de bases de datos y validación de grabaciones de repetición. Esencial para garantizar que los componentes funcionen juntos correctamente. Fuente: ecto/muni.
Datos (listos para citar)
Campos y comandos estables para citas de IA/búsqueda.
- Comando de instalación
npx skills add https://github.com/ecto/muni --skill integration-testing- Fuente
- ecto/muni
- Categoría
- </>Desarrollo
- Verificado
- ✓
- Primera vez visto
- 2026-02-01
- Actualizado
- 2026-02-18
Respuestas rápidas
¿Qué es integration-testing?
Guía de pruebas, simulacros y simulaciones de un extremo a otro para el código base de Muni. Úselo al escribir pruebas de integración, configurar entornos de prueba, crear simulacros de bus CAN, probar protocolos WebSocket, validar dispositivos de bases de datos o depurar fallas de pruebas. Cubre patrones de prueba de Rust (tokio::test, pruebas de integración), pruebas de TypeScript (Vitest), infraestructura simulada (Docker Compose para pruebas), simulación de bus CAN, clientes de prueba WebSocket, inicialización de bases de datos y validación de grabaciones de repetición. Esencial para garantizar que los componentes funcionen juntos correctamente. Fuente: ecto/muni.
¿Cómo instalo integration-testing?
Abre tu terminal o herramienta de línea de comandos (Terminal, iTerm, Windows Terminal, etc.) Copia y ejecuta este comando: npx skills add https://github.com/ecto/muni --skill integration-testing Una vez instalado, el skill se configurará automáticamente en tu entorno de programación con IA y estará listo para usar en Claude Code o Cursor
¿Dónde está el repositorio de origen?
https://github.com/ecto/muni
Detalles
- Categoría
- </>Desarrollo
- Fuente
- skills.sh
- Primera vez visto
- 2026-02-01